Seva Mining is a member of the Fiore Group, a collection of leading precious metals companies focused on creating shareholder value through strategic acquisitions and resources development.
Seva Mining’s Cameron Gold Project spans 53,000 hectares in Northwest Ontario and hosts a 1.25Moz Gold Resource, as well as a 13,630m3 mineralized stockpile from previous underground workings (1980s). First Mining, headed by Chairman Keith Neumeyer, is the largest shareholder at 44.7%.

What do you think makes your company such a compelling investment?
Seva is a Fiore Group company with an experienced and dedicated team focused on 6 pillars of growth:
1) Existing high-grade resource: 515koz M&I, 714koz Inferred, 1.25Moz contained gold.
2) Mineralized Stockpile Optionality: 13,630m3 mineralized stockpile grading 3.5g/t Au provides near-term toll milling potential and cash flow optionality.
3) M&A: Strategic position to consolidate undervalued assets in the proven gold district, creating a larger, more valuable platform.
4) Exploration upside at Cameron: Significant untested potential and 25,000m of drilling planned to expand existing 1.25Moz resource.
5) DSO Approach: Shipping high-grade ore to nearby mills could enable a low-CAPEX mine build.
6) Existing Infrastructure: Project is already connected to paved highways with established logging roads, and with power nearby.
